Experience the beauty of the Cairngorm National Park!
Sharing with you history, culture and folklore of this beautiful area where I live.

We travel back in time with a visit to the Highland Folk Museum, setting for Outlander, Mackenzie village scenes, before visiting Ruthven Barracks, built early 1700 and where jacobites regrouped following the battle of Culloden.

We then travel to Loch an Eilein, with the water reflecting the magnificent pines and views of the ruined island castle.

We will then drive to Cairngorm mountain car park and enjoy the views across the valley with opportunity for short walk and or enjoy a coffee.

Stopping at Loch Morlich beach as we descend towards the village of Aviemore
With time for a whisky tasting at the Snug / Gin Tasting, Kinrara / Cairngorm Brewery options

Ending the day with sheep dog demonstration.
